Sérgio Sette Câmara will be on the track in search of a new podium

The period of European high summer is coming to an end and, as a result, the competitions of the old continent are resuming its calendars to the complementation of the 2015 season. Within this spirit, the European F3 Championship will have this weekend,  from September 4 to 6, its ninth round of the season with races 25, 26 and 27. The disputes will be held on the International  Algarve Circuit, in Portugal.

The pilot Sergio Sette Câmara (Banco Mercantil do Brasil / Lalubema / Motopark Academy), after spending three weeks with his family and friends here in Brazil, is back to his daily racing routine. Excited about the growing performance in the Championship,  the 17-year old pilot is very confident in a fruitful season finale

“This end of season has everything to be very good for us. We have the races this weekend in Portimão and then we will follow to Nurburgring and Hockenheim, in Germany. Unlike most of the tracks, in which I didn’t know, I have driven on these three race tracks. Either in trainings or even in races. . This, coupled with the good performance we had in the last rounds of the Championship, make me pretty confident in the quest for good results on the races this weekend and also  on the other two final rounds”, commented the pilot.

The International Algarve Circuit is one of the newest and modern racetracks of Europe. In a project valued at nearly € 200 million, the track has a 4,692 meters design and has a capacity for an audience of 100 thousand people. During the lap, which is performed clockwise, the pilots remain 81% of the time in  full acceleration. A total of 31 gear changes  are made  and the maximum speed of the F3 car reaches approximately 245 km/h.
